Former President Chandrika Kumaratunga Congratulates Vijay on Notable Achievement
Former Sri Lankan President Chandrika Bandaranaike Kumaratunga expressed her fond memories of the enduring and amicable relationship between the Tamil Nadu region of India and Sri Lanka. In her recent statement, she conveyed optimism for the continuation of this friendly association under the current governance.
Kumaratungas remarks highlight the historical ties between Tamil Nadu and Sri Lanka, which date back centuries and are rooted in cultural and linguistic connections, as well as shared Tamil heritage. Leaders from both regions have often emphasized the importance of maintaining strong diplomatic and cultural relations, which can contribute to mutual economic growth and stability. As Sri Lanka seeks to strengthen its ties with neighboring regions, the sentiments expressed by Kumaratunga reflect a desire for collaboration and understanding moving forward.
